TURN-208: Gatevale turnstile counters at the Merrow Field pilot double-count when a rotation reverses mid-cycle. Attendance totals drift roughly 2% high per event. The debounce window fix is implemented, reviewed by Ilsa, and soak-tested across two simulated match days without drift. Ready for your cut; the candidate build is identified below.

trace token, tagag-tafog: htk6_5ed18c

Handover: ConsentGate rollout

Taking over from Priya. Banner is live on tier-1 tenants; tier-2 goes Thursday. Plugin authors: your consent hooks now fire before DOM ready, so register early or you'll miss the event. Legacy callback API is deprecated but still shimmed until the next minor release. Rollout flags are managed centrally — don't override them locally. The current rollout configuration pushed to all plugin hosts is as follows.

deployment values, fahap-hahaf:
[casdor]
port = 9200
region = south-2
host = casdor.qirvanworks.corp
timeout_ms = 3000
retries = 4

Slatemap's tile-rendering cache sits between the renderer and object storage. Entries are keyed by zoom, x, y, and style hash; TTL is 14 days, evicted LRU. Cache misses fan out to the render pool, capped at 64 concurrent jobs. Purge by style hash only, never by region. Administrative purge calls authenticate with the key below.

gateway credential: kto23_LX9A4ys6i4nzHtpOLNLodKK